Sickle cell anemia is a trait that exhibits codominance. A person with an AA genotype does not have sickle cell anemia, and a person with an SS genotype has full sickle cell anemia. A person with an AS genotype will have some sickle-cells, though s/he might show minimal or no symptoms (a “carrier”).
